Overflowing Gutters

Overflow can come from clogs, poor pitch, undersized gutter runs, loose sections, or downspouts that cannot move water away fast enough.

Poor Downspout Drainage

Downspouts that discharge beside the foundation can cause pooling, erosion, basement moisture, crawlspace issues, and soil movement around the property.

Should I take photos before requesting downspout storm damage repair?

Ground-level photos can help show where the concern is located, but avoid climbing on the roof or unsafe areas. Photos of leaks, damage, debris, gutters, siding, or interior stains can be useful.
